WPNotif 3.1.1 – WordPress SMS & WhatsApp Message Notifications

WPNotif – WordPress SMS & WhatsApp Message Notifications: A Comprehensive Guide
WPNotif is a WordPress plugin designed to facilitate SMS and WhatsApp message notifications for a variety of events occurring on your website. This allows for real-time communication with your users, leading to improved engagement, customer service, and overall user experience. This article provides a detailed look at WPNotif, its features, benefits, installation, configuration, and best practices for effective implementation.
Understanding the Core Functionality of WPNotif
WPNotif bridges the gap between your WordPress website and the world of mobile messaging. It allows you to automate the sending of SMS and WhatsApp notifications to users based on specific triggers within your WordPress environment. These triggers can range from user registration to order updates, providing timely and relevant information directly to their mobile devices.
Key Features of WPNotif
* SMS and WhatsApp Notifications: Sends notifications via both SMS and WhatsApp, offering flexibility in communication.
* Event-Based Triggers: Supports a wide array of triggers based on events occurring within WordPress, such as:
- New user registration
- Order placement
- Order status updates
- Appointment booking
- Form submissions
- Blog post publishing
- Comment posting
- WooCommerce events
* Customizable Message Templates: Provides the ability to create personalized message templates for each trigger, ensuring relevant and branded communication.
* Gateway Integration: Integrates with various SMS and WhatsApp gateway providers, giving you the freedom to choose the best option for your needs and budget. Popular gateways include Twilio, Plivo, Nexmo, and WhatsApp Business API.
* User Group Segmentation: Allows you to segment users into groups based on various criteria and send targeted notifications to specific groups.
* Opt-In/Opt-Out Functionality: Provides users with the option to subscribe to or unsubscribe from notifications, ensuring compliance with privacy regulations.
* Delivery Reporting: Tracks the delivery status of sent messages, providing insights into the effectiveness of your notification strategy.
* Shortcode Support: Offers shortcodes to embed subscription forms and other elements within your website content.
* Multilingual Support: Supports multiple languages, allowing you to communicate with users in their preferred language.
* API Integration: Provides an API for developers to integrate WPNotif with other applications and services.
* GDPR Compliance: Helps you comply with GDPR regulations by providing features for user consent and data management.
Benefits of Using WPNotif
Implementing WPNotif on your WordPress website can yield significant benefits for your business and your users.
* Improved User Engagement: Timely notifications keep users informed and engaged with your website, leading to increased interaction and loyalty.
* Enhanced Customer Service: Proactive notifications about order updates, appointment reminders, and support requests can significantly improve customer satisfaction.
* Increased Sales and Conversions: Notifications about promotions, abandoned carts, and new product launches can drive sales and conversions.
* Reduced Communication Costs: Automating notifications can reduce the need for manual communication, saving time and resources.
* Streamlined Workflow: Automates various communication processes, freeing up staff to focus on other tasks.
* Better Security: Notifications about account activity, such as password changes, can help improve security.
* Real-Time Updates: Delivers instant updates to users, ensuring they are always informed about important events.
Installation and Configuration of WPNotif
Installing and configuring WPNotif is a relatively straightforward process. The following steps outline the general procedure:
1. Plugin Installation
* Navigate to your WordPress dashboard and go to “Plugins” -> “Add New”.
* Search for “WPNotif” in the search bar.
* Click on the “Install Now” button next to the WPNotif plugin.
* Once installed, click on the “Activate” button to activate the plugin.
2. Gateway Configuration
* After activation, a WPNotif menu item will appear in your WordPress dashboard. Click on it.
* Navigate to the “Settings” or “Gateway Settings” section.
* Choose your desired SMS and/or WhatsApp gateway provider.
* Enter the required API credentials for your chosen gateway. This typically includes API keys, API secrets, and sender IDs. The specific requirements vary depending on the gateway.
* Save your gateway settings.
3. Notification Settings
* Navigate to the “Notifications” section.
* You will see a list of available event triggers.
* For each trigger you want to enable, click on the “Edit” or “Configure” button.
* Configure the message template for the selected trigger. You can use placeholders to insert dynamic data, such as the user’s name, order ID, or appointment date.
* Select the user roles or groups that should receive the notification.
* Enable or disable the notification for SMS and/or WhatsApp.
* Save your notification settings.
4. Opt-In/Opt-Out Configuration
* Navigate to the “Opt-In/Opt-Out” section.
* Configure the opt-in and opt-out settings for SMS and WhatsApp notifications.
* You can customize the opt-in message and the opt-out process.
* You can also integrate the opt-in form into your website using shortcodes.
5. Testing
* After configuring the plugin, it’s essential to test the notifications to ensure they are working correctly.
* Trigger the events you have configured and verify that the notifications are sent to your mobile device.
* If you encounter any issues, review your gateway settings and notification settings.
Choosing the Right Gateway Provider
Selecting the appropriate gateway provider is a crucial step in implementing WPNotif effectively. Consider the following factors when making your decision:
* Pricing: Compare the pricing models of different gateway providers. Some providers offer pay-as-you-go pricing, while others offer subscription-based plans. Consider the volume of messages you anticipate sending and choose a pricing plan that fits your budget.
* Reliability: Choose a gateway provider with a proven track record of reliability and uptime. Look for providers with robust infrastructure and redundant systems.
* Delivery Rates: Check the delivery rates of different gateway providers for your target countries. Some providers may have better delivery rates in certain regions than others.
* Features: Consider the features offered by different gateway providers. Some providers offer advanced features such as message scheduling, two-way messaging, and analytics.
* Support: Choose a gateway provider that offers excellent customer support. Look for providers with readily available documentation, tutorials, and responsive support teams.
* WhatsApp Business API Compliance: If using WhatsApp, ensure the provider is an official WhatsApp Business API provider to comply with WhatsApp’s terms of service.
Popular SMS gateway providers include:
* Twilio
* Plivo
* Nexmo (Vonage)
* Clickatell
* MessageBird
Popular WhatsApp gateway providers include:
* Twilio (via WhatsApp Business API)
* Gupshup
* MessageBird
* 360dialog
Best Practices for Effective WPNotif Implementation
To maximize the benefits of WPNotif, consider the following best practices:
* Personalize Your Messages: Use placeholders to insert dynamic data into your messages, making them more personalized and relevant to the recipient.
* Keep Messages Concise: Keep your messages short and to the point. Mobile users are often on the go and may not have time to read lengthy messages.
* Use a Clear Call to Action: Include a clear call to action in your messages, telling users what you want them to do.
* Segment Your Audience: Segment your users into groups based on various criteria and send targeted notifications to specific groups.
* Test Your Messages: Test your messages thoroughly before sending them to your entire audience. This will help you identify any errors and ensure that your messages are effective.
* Monitor Your Delivery Rates: Monitor your delivery rates to ensure that your messages are being delivered successfully. If you notice any issues, contact your gateway provider for assistance.
* Provide Opt-In/Opt-Out Options: Always provide users with the option to subscribe to or unsubscribe from notifications. This is essential for complying with privacy regulations and maintaining a positive user experience.
* Comply with Regulations: Familiarize yourself with the regulations governing SMS and WhatsApp messaging in your region and ensure that your use of WPNotif complies with these regulations. GDPR, TCPA, and other privacy laws should be taken into account.
* Use Double Opt-In: Implement double opt-in for subscriptions. This requires users to confirm their subscription via email or SMS, ensuring they genuinely want to receive notifications.
* Respect User Preferences: Allow users to customize their notification preferences. This gives them more control over the types of notifications they receive.
* Optimize for Mobile: Ensure your website and landing pages are optimized for mobile devices, as users will likely be accessing them from their mobile phones after receiving a notification.
* Track Conversions: Track conversions from your notifications to measure their effectiveness and optimize your strategy.
* Monitor Performance: Regularly monitor the performance of your notifications and make adjustments as needed. Analyze open rates, click-through rates, and conversion rates to identify areas for improvement.
* Provide Value: Ensure your notifications provide genuine value to the recipient. Avoid sending spam or irrelevant messages.
* Respect Frequency: Avoid sending too many notifications, as this can be annoying and lead users to unsubscribe.
* Utilize Analytics: Use the analytics provided by your gateway provider and WPNotif to gain insights into your notification performance.
Troubleshooting Common Issues
While WPNotif is designed to be user-friendly, you may encounter some issues during installation and configuration. Here are some common issues and their solutions:
* Notifications Not Being Sent:
- Verify your gateway settings. Ensure that your API credentials are correct and that your account has sufficient credits.
- Check your notification settings. Make sure that the notifications are enabled for the correct user roles and groups.
- Review your message templates. Ensure that there are no errors in your message templates.
- Check your spam filters. Some SMS and WhatsApp providers may have spam filters that are blocking your messages.
- Contact your gateway provider for assistance.
* Delivery Issues:
- Check the delivery reports in WPNotif.
- Verify the recipient’s phone number.
- Contact your gateway provider to investigate the issue.
* Plugin Conflicts:
- Deactivate other plugins one by one to identify any conflicts.
- Contact the WPNotif support team for assistance.
* WhatsApp Business API Issues:
- Ensure your WhatsApp Business API account is active and properly configured.
- Check that your message templates are approved by WhatsApp.
- Verify your business name and profile information are accurate.
Conclusion
WPNotif offers a powerful and versatile solution for integrating SMS and WhatsApp notifications into your WordPress website. By leveraging its features and following the best practices outlined in this article, you can significantly improve user engagement, customer service, and overall website performance. Remember to carefully choose your gateway provider, configure your notification settings correctly, and continuously monitor your notification performance to maximize the benefits of WPNotif.